taken from the notes of Dr. Lendon Smith, M.D.** What are the causes of arthritis? **
When a foreign substance enters the body it activates the immune system. Then the T and B-cells release factors that stimulate the synovial macrophages to release cytokines. The two cytokines which are believed to play a major role in Rheumatoid Arthritis are interleukin-1 and tumor necrosis factor alpha. These two cytokines produce collagenase and other proteases that destroy the cartilage. The factors that activate the macrophages to produce these cytokines include bacterial and viral products, immune complexes, complement components, and cytokines themselves.
** What are some treatments for arthritis? **
* Gamma-linoleic acid form fish oils is an effective treatment for active RA. These oils are comprised of docosahexaenoic acid and eicosapentaneoic acid. They make prostaglandins of the E-3 series.
* Glucosamine sulfate is needed by our connective tissue. It is part of the cellular cement and is elevated in our joints affording protection against the destruction of the joints. The NSAIDS (non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s) and corticosteroids inhibit necessary prostaglandin synthesis.
* Proanthocyanidins are plant flavonoids that have exhibited extremely high antioxidant activity. Free radical activity is implicated in cartilage damage and arthritis, flavonoids have potential to slow inflammatory conditions of Rheumatoid Arthritis. Flavonoids improve capillary integrity and stabilize the collagen matrix. Hawthorn berries and grape seed extract are high in proanthocyanidins.
